Dear PDWG,
I have been following the discussions on the hierarchical AS‑SET naming
scheme and would like clarification on a few points:
1. Could this matter be addressed operationally, as is done in ARIN,
LACNIC, and RIPE NCC, without requiring policy changes?
2. If yes, why are we taking the policy route? Is it because AFRINIC
currently lacks a defined process for handling operational issues that
affect IRR services?
3. Given that the hierarchical naming scheme is already supported and
currently exists within the IRR, this proposal represents an enforcement
change rather than the introduction of a new technical standard. Why is a
formal policy required to change an operational enforcement setting, rather
than a community-vetted technical implementation plan?"
Thank you.
